What are the pilot cities for cross-regional transfer of used cars?

1 Answers
MacAdeline
07/29/25 2:06pm
The 'Notice' clarifies that starting from June 1, 2021, pilot programs for cross-regional transaction registration of non-operational used cars will be implemented in 20 cities including Tianjin, Taiyuan, Shenyang, and Shanghai. The pilot cities for cross-regional transfer of used cars are: Tianjin, Taiyuan, Shenyang, Nanjing, Suzhou, Hangzhou, Ningbo, Hefei, Fuzhou, Zibo, Zhengzhou, Wuhan, Shenzhen, Nanning, Chongqing, Chengdu, Kunming, Xining. Below are some considerations when purchasing a used car: Documentation: Ensure that the vehicle's documents are authentic and complete, that the engine and chassis numbers on the documents match those on the vehicle, and verify whether the vehicle can be transferred. Check if the vehicle has any mortgages, court seizures, economic disputes, unresolved traffic violations, or if the inspection and insurance are overdue. For vehicles registered under corporate accounts, confirm if there are any specific local transfer requirements. Vehicle Condition: Exercise caution when considering vehicles in poor condition, no matter how cheap they are. After identifying the ideal model, if the budget allows, prioritize vehicles that are newer in terms of age.

What is the ground clearance of the CRV?

CRV classic model has a minimum ground clearance of 135MM, while mid-to-high-end models have a minimum ground clearance of 137MM. The following is relevant information: 1. Ground clearance refers to the distance between the ground and the rigid object at the bottom of the vehicle. The ground clearance of a vehicle varies depending on whether it is unloaded or loaded. Ground clearance is divided into unloaded and loaded conditions. The ground clearance when loaded is also called the minimum ground clearance, which refers to the shortest distance between the lowest protruding part of the vehicle's chassis and the ground when the vehicle is parked horizontally under the rated full load condition. 2. Ground clearance is related to the vehicle's load. The heavier the load, the smaller the ground clearance. Vehicles with low ground clearance have a lower center of gravity but poor passability. Vehicles with high ground clearance have good passability. In addition to performing well on gravel and mountain roads, high ground clearance can also prevent water from entering the exhaust pipe when driving through flooded roads and make it easier to park on curbs or other parking spaces with height differences.

Can I Still Drive When the New Car Prompts for an Oil Change?

When a new car prompts for an oil change, you can still drive it normally. The oil change reminder is a maintenance cycle alert preset by the manufacturer, simply indicating that it's time for vehicle maintenance. However, you should not drive excessively long distances without changing the oil, as prolonged use without an oil change may cause damage to the vehicle. Below is relevant information about oil selection: 1. Choose engine oil based on the engine's requirements. There's no need to use overly advanced oil in engines with lower requirements, nor should you use lower-grade oil in engines with higher demands. 2. Multi-grade oil is recommended due to its cost-effectiveness, long lifespan, and high efficiency, providing better protection for the engine. Given its characteristics, multi-grade oil may appear darker earlier or exhibit lower oil pressure compared to conventional oil, both of which are normal. 3. Some domestic brand oils offer excellent quality at a much lower price than imported counterparts, making them a reliable choice. 4. If the engine is in good condition and the seasonal temperature is low, using lower-viscosity oil is advisable to ensure smooth oil flow. In high-temperature seasons or when the engine is severely worn, higher-viscosity oil helps form an oil film, reducing engine wear.

Is There Purchase Tax for Hybrid Vehicles?

Hybrid vehicles are exempt from purchase tax, according to the national regulations on new energy vehicles, which enjoy the policy of exemption from vehicle purchase tax. Here is the relevant information: The meaning of vehicle purchase tax: Vehicle purchase tax is a tax levied on units and individuals who purchase specified vehicles within the country, evolved from the vehicle purchase surcharge. The calculation method of purchase tax: Vehicle purchase tax is calculated based on the ad valorem rate method, and the formula is: Tax payable = Taxable price × Tax rate. If the consumer buys a domestic private car, the taxable price is the total price and additional fees paid to the dealer, excluding the value-added tax (VAT rate of 13%). Since the purchase price in the special invoice for motor vehicle sales includes VAT, the 13% VAT must be deducted first when calculating the vehicle purchase tax, i.e., the taxable price for vehicle purchase tax = Invoice price ÷ 1.13, and then the vehicle purchase tax is calculated at a rate of 10%.

How to Solve the Oil Burning Issue in Tiguan?

The solution to the oil burning issue in Tiguan: Timely maintenance should be conducted to prevent engine damage. The reasons for oil burning in Tiguan include the following: 1. Aging of valve oil seals. 2. Severe wear of piston rings, leading to excessive clearance between the piston and the cylinder wall. 3. Loose valve guides. These factors cause engine oil to enter the cylinder and participate in combustion. Below is a detailed introduction to the importance of lubricating oil for the engine: 1. The general requirements for an engine are small size, lightweight, compact structure, and high output power, which means its unit friction surface bears a significant load. 2. In addition to frictional heat, the engine is also affected by combustion heat, resulting in high temperatures on the friction surfaces, which reduces the viscosity of the lubricating oil and makes it difficult to form an oil film. 3. High-temperature and high-pressure combustion gases in the combustion chamber can leak into the crankcase through the gaps between the piston, piston rings, and cylinder liner. These combustion gases are the result of complete and incomplete combustion of fuel and a small amount of lubricating oil, producing gases and certain particulate matter (soot), which typically become the main components of crankcase blow-by. They can contaminate the lubricating oil and, under certain conditions, accelerate its oxidation.
